It is a Monday morning in April of 2020 and I wake up with my anxiety racing.\u00a0 It\u2019s 5am, my girls will be up within the next hour.\u00a0 I am awake early to find some solace before a hectic day at home, but I am already stressed.\u00a0 Today I have a meeting from 10am-12pm and I don\u2019t have any childcare coverage.\u00a0 It will be fine, I tell myself.\u00a0 They have played on their own for 2 hours many times before, I will put on a movie if I need to, it will be fine. Stop stressing.\u00a0\u00a0 I have a flexible job, which means I am the default parent.\u00a0 Which means my work and my parenting collide worlds more often than I would like. I asked for this. I wanted a flexible job so that I could be home with my kids, this is what I signed up for. But what I didn&#8217;t anticipate in this mix is how hard some days would truly be. How some days the energy it took to bounce from mom mode to work mode was enough to leave me feeling like I belonged in an insane asylum. There are days I really do wish I could keep home and work separate, but the pandemic brought a whole new level of complexity to working from home. If I get a sitter, I am putting my family at risk for COVID19.\u00a0 If I don\u2019t get a sitter, I run the risk of losing my patience on my kids&#8230;again. Or with no help, I run the risk of being both a terrible employee and a terrible mother.\u00a0 Sweet. 9:45am rolls around.\u00a0 I set out a table full of snacks and put on a movie.\u00a0 My girls don\u2019t get movies or TV much so when it is on they are LOCKED IN.\u00a0 In comes the guilt.\u00a0 Really, Jill? Using TV as a babysitter? It\u2019s fine, I tell myself, it is a rainy day out, we had a busy weekend, it will be good for them to chill out this morning with a movie while I sit in this meeting. &nbsp; You are a good Mom, it\u2019s just one flipping disney movie. It\u2019s fine.&nbsp; Meeting starts rolling and all is well.\u00a0 Girls whine at each other here and there, but otherwise smooth sailing. Until 11:00am. My 4 year old\u00a0 starts whining that her sister is touching her.\u00a0 Then her little sister starts crying because her dress is bothering her and needs to go get changed. I look at my zoom screen. \u00a0MUTE. VIDEO OFF.\u00a0 I help her change, being anything but the kind and gentle Mom I want to be. I rush her through, I plop her back in front of the movie and come back to the meeting. Guilt guilt guilt.\u00a0It&#8217;s fine. I&#8217;m fine. My 3 year old continues to start whining again, now crying, now screaming.\u00a0 Oh no. I know this scream, she has to poop.\u00a0 No no no no no not now.\u00a0 I am supposed to actually talk in this meeting in a minute, please not now.\u00a0 The screams grow louder.\u00a0 Poop all over the floor.\u00a0 The 4 year old is also now screaming out of disgust. I privately message my colleague to ask her if she can give my update.\u00a0 Terrible employee. \u00a0I yell at my 3 year old for pooping all over the floor even though it is not her fault, she cries harder.\u00a0 Terrible mother. I am so frustrated. I am so overwhelmed. The meeting ends and I realize I\u2019ve barely been able to be present for much of it and of course my kids go back to playing nicely. I also realize how mean I was to them in that two hour span. It wasn\u2019t their fault I had a meeting.&nbsp; It\u2019s not their fault I\u2019m trying to do two things at once.&nbsp; I cannot do both.&nbsp; I cannot keep doing both.&nbsp; I am not even DOING both.&nbsp; I am ready to break.&nbsp; It is not fine, I am not fine. Nursing a baby while conducting a meeting via zoom.\u00a0 Finding creative ways to occupy a toddler that is not screen time (but sometimes desperation wins).\u00a0 Navigating childcare inconsistencies, employee needs, E-learning, dinner to be made, reports to be run, butts to be wiped and programs to plan. This is just a sliver of what women have carried this year. The media calls us superwomen, the true heroes of the pandemic.\u00a0 But if I could guess, most of us don\u2019t actually want to be superwoman.\u00a0 Most of us just want help, we just want to complete a single task or thought without interruption. We want rest and we want the expectations of working moms to be blown to bits once and for all.
